Table 2 Preliminary evaluation of sensitivity, specificity, positive and negative predicted values for the Nb44/Nb42 LFA performed on plasma samples from experimentally infected cattle.

From: Development of a Nanobody-based lateral flow assay to detect active Trypanosoma congolense infections

Sensitivity ± 95% CI (%)

79.17 (19/24) ± 16.25

Specificity ± 95% CI (%)

91.89 (34/37) ± 8.80

PPV ± 95% CI (%)

86.36 (19/22) ± 14.34

NPV ± 95% CI (%)

87.18 (34/39) ± 10.47

  1. The samples were obtained from a stored GALVmed plasma sample collection at Clinvet, South Africa. The collection contains plasma samples of Holstein cows that were experimentally infected with T. vivax STIB 719 or T. congolense KONT 2/133. Because these animals were involved in drug development programs, they were treated as soon mild disease symptoms developed combined with an observed hematocrit value lower than 25%.
